The differentiation between ceramic and terra cotta plant containers relies on observation of physical properties, specifically color, texture, and manufacturing process. Terra cotta, typically unglazed and reddish-brown due to its iron oxide content, exhibits a coarser texture. Ceramic pots, conversely, often feature a glazed surface and are available in a broader spectrum of colors, achieved through the application of pigments during the firing process. Observing these characteristics provides a practical method for distinction.
Accurate identification of a plant container’s composition is important for informed plant care. Terra cotta’s porous nature allows for increased air circulation and moisture evaporation, benefiting plants that prefer drier soil conditions. Ceramic containers, especially those that are glazed, retain moisture more effectively, suiting plants with higher water requirements. Understanding these properties contributes to optimal plant health and growth.
